On Thu, 13 Mar 2014 17:34:02 +0100 Vadim Zeitlin <vz-mahog...@zeitlins.org> wrote:
VZ> NB> my own compiled wx has '#define wxTYPE_SA_HANDLER int' in setup.h, VZ> NB> but Fedora wxGTK3-devel package has /* #undef wxTYPE_SA_HANDLER */ VZ> NB> in setup.h. VZ> VZ> I don't understand how did this happen. Did they use --disable-catch_segvs VZ> explicitly when building it? Because otherwise I just don't see how is this VZ> possible :-( wxGTK-devel-2.8.12 also has it undefined. And yes, both 2.8 and 3.0 source rpms have --disable-catch_segvs. BTW, 2.8 has --enable-compat24, while 3.0 has --disable-compat28. Strange choices imho... VZ> I think you should just replace wxTYPE_SA_HANDLER with int here, this is VZ> POSIX and there shouldn't be any supported non-POSIX platforms any more. VZ> Could you please test this and commit it if it works? Done. Regards, Nerijus ------------------------------------------------------------------------------ Learn Graph Databases - Download FREE O'Reilly Book "Graph Databases" is the definitive new guide to graph databases and their applications. Written by three acclaimed leaders in the field, this first edition is now available. Download your free book today! http://p.sf.net/sfu/13534_NeoTech _______________________________________________ Mahogany-Developers mailing list Mahogany-Developers@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/mahogany-developers